Architect, Appl Development->> Designs technical infrastructure for applications. Translates user requirements to process data needs. Designs application technical infrastructure such as specific databases, programming languages, utilities, testing approach, and tools. Participates in the evaluation and implementation of vendor application software and tools. Provides broad understanding of platforms and applications across all technologies by consulting with the project teams and assisting the groups in their technical training needs. Constructs program flow charts to describe the processing of data and development of precise steps and processing logic across all platforms. Converts specifications about business problems into sequence of detailed programming instructions to solve business problems through automation support. Advocates for change to provide innovative, creating technology solutions as appropriate to meet client needs. Helps resolve system problems affecting primary applications or across multiple platforms using the appropriate debugging tools and techniques such as probes, animators, traces, sniffers and dumps. * Prior Mainframe Modernization experience.
* Rearchitect. Materially alter the application code so you can shift it to a new application architecture and fully exploit new and better capabilities of the application platform.


* Rebuild. Rebuild or rewrite the application component from scratch while preserving its scope and specifications.


* Replace. Eliminate the former application component altogether and replace it, taking new requirements and needs into account.
